CHOOSE ANTENNA CONFIGURATION
The 300SR receiver has two antenna configurations:
CHOOSE FREQUENCY
Receiver
Set the 300SR receiver to one of the following frequencies:
•
power (50 Hz or 60 Hz)
•
radio
•
active (8 kHz or 29 kHz)
Transmitter
Your 300ST transmitter was configured at the time of purchase to
send either 8 kHz or 29 kHz signals.
send either 8 kHz or 29 kHz signals.
Antenna
Description
When to use
peak
Uses two horizontal
antenna to detect signal.
Response is highest at
strongest signal.
